An 800 MW coal fired power plant supplies electricity to 500,000 homes. The power plant has a capacity factor of 85%, an availability of 95%, and an overall cycle efficiency of 30% based on higher heating value. The coal used to fuel the plant has a heating value of 24 MJ/kg. Assume the electricity has a transmission efficiency of 94%.

a. How much electrical energy is generated annually by the power plant (MWh/yr)?

b. How many metric tons of coal are required to fuel the plant annually (Mg/yr)?

c. What is the average annual household electricity usage (kWh/home-yr)? Assume all generated electricity is used to supply the 500,000 households.
